Transaction ecb72250c2820063c9a079102196d9df5211264a771f1e84042d08bf814f8a9a
1 Input
1 Output
-
ecb72250c2820063c9a079102196d9df5211264a771f1e84042d08bf814f8a9a:0
- value
- 216649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c59e4d9467b6a84f6e4544de7a3d178bd49e3c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M67M9JccyiDwZPQ8ZsJGKtTgUFbUtUkrp